Kelvin Davis signs new Saints deal

Saints have extended the contract of club captain Kelvin Davis until 2016, it has been announced.

The 36-year-old keeper's previous deal had been due to run through to the summer of 2014, but, despite having lost his position as the number one stopper at St Mary's, he has been given another two years.

Davis joined Saints from Sunderland in July 2006, for a fee of £1m, and has gone on to make 283 appearances for the club.

His updated contract will extend his period of service at Saints to a decade, taking him through to his testimonial season.

Davis has made it clear for some time that he wants to see out his playing days at St Mary's, and with his new deal taking him up to within a few months of his 40th birthday, it looks like he may be granted his wish.
